Output 07110f5cca8d6c3c053fdfbb53841839a0291e5f0cf6ac80c04fef9868232d19:1

value
17587680
script pubkey
OP_0 OP_PUSHBYTES_20 ef7ba98fe0cdcdd41fdb47f50a16f647842e4073
address
ltc1qaaa6nrlqehxag87mgl6s59hkg7zzusrn0semca
transaction
07110f5cca8d6c3c053fdfbb53841839a0291e5f0cf6ac80c04fef9868232d19
spent
true